Nnamdi Obi

Principal Legal Officer at NAFDAC Nigeria

Nnamdi Obi possesses extensive legal experience, currently serving as Principal Legal Officer at NAFDAC Nigeria since October 2016. Prior roles include legal practitioner at Jude & George from November 2010 to October 2016 and Litigation Associate at Kayode Oduba & Co from November 2009 to August 2010. Nnamdi's career began as Sales Manager at Upson Communication Ltd from January 2006 to August 2007. Educational qualifications include a Master of Laws (LLM) in Maritime Law from the University of Hertfordshire (2013-2014), a Bachelor of Laws (LLB) in Commercial Law from Enugu State University of Science and Technology (2001-2005), and a B.L. from the Nigerian Law School in Lagos (2007-2008).

NAFDAC Nigeria

The National Agency for Food and Drug Administration and Control (NAFDAC) was established by Decree No. 15 of 1993 as amended by Decree No. 19 of 1999 and now the National Agency for Food and Drug Administration and Control Act Cap NI Laws of the Federation of Nigeria (LFN) 2004 to regulate and control the manufacture, importation, exportation, distribution, advertisement, sale and use of Food, Drugs, Cosmetics, Medical Devices, Packaged Water, Chemicals and Detergents (collectively known as regulated products). The agency was officially established in October 1992.
